diff --git a/BaseTools/Scripts/GccBase.lds b/BaseTools/Scripts/GccBase.lds index 9f27e83bb0..6081a66dfe 100644 --- a/BaseTools/Scripts/GccBase.lds +++ b/BaseTools/Scripts/GccBase.lds @@ -1,88 +1,88 @@ -/** @file
-
- Unified linker script for GCC based builds
-
- Copyright (c) 2010 - 2015, Intel Corporation. All rights reserved.<BR>
- Copyright (c) 2015, Linaro Ltd. All rights reserved.<BR>
- (C) Copyright 2016 Hewlett Packard Enterprise Development LP<BR>
-
- SPDX-License-Identifier: BSD-2-Clause-Patent
-
-**/
-
-SECTIONS {
-
- /*
- * The PE/COFF binary consists of DOS and PE/COFF headers, and a sequence of
- * section headers adding up to PECOFF_HEADER_SIZE bytes (which differs
- * between 32-bit and 64-bit builds). The actual start of the .text section
- * will be rounded up based on its actual alignment.
- */
- . = PECOFF_HEADER_SIZE;
-
- .text : ALIGN(CONSTANT(COMMONPAGESIZE)) {
- *(.text .text.* .stub .gnu.linkonce.t.*)
- *(.rodata .rodata.* .gnu.linkonce.r.*)
- *(.got .got.*)
-
- /*
- * The contents of AutoGen.c files are mostly constant from the POV of the
- * program, but most of it ends up in .data or .bss by default since few of
- * the variable definitions that get emitted are declared as CONST.
- * Unfortunately, we cannot pull it into the .text section entirely, since
- * patchable PCDs are also emitted here, but we can at least move all of the
- * emitted GUIDs here.
- */
- *:AutoGen.obj(.data.g*Guid)
- }
-
- /*
- * The alignment of the .data section should be less than or equal to the
- * alignment of the .text section. This ensures that the relative offset
- * between these sections is the same in the ELF and the PE/COFF versions of
- * this binary.
- */
- .data ALIGN(ALIGNOF(.text)) : ALIGN(CONSTANT(COMMONPAGESIZE)) {
- *(.data .data.* .gnu.linkonce.d.*)
- *(.bss .bss.*)
- }
-
- .eh_frame ALIGN(CONSTANT(COMMONPAGESIZE)) : {
- KEEP (*(.eh_frame))
- }
-
- .rela (INFO) : {
- *(.rela .rela.*)
- }
-
- .hii : ALIGN(CONSTANT(COMMONPAGESIZE)) {
- KEEP (*(.hii))
- }
-
- .got : {
- *(.got)
- }
- ASSERT(SIZEOF(.got) == 0, "Unexpected GOT entries detected!")
-
- .got.plt (INFO) : {
- *(.got.plt)
- }
- ASSERT(SIZEOF(.got.plt) == 0 || SIZEOF(.got.plt) == 0xc || SIZEOF(.got.plt) == 0x18, "Unexpected GOT/PLT entries detected!")
-
- /*
- * Retain the GNU build id but in a non-allocatable section so GenFw
- * does not copy it into the PE/COFF image.
- */
- .build-id (INFO) : { *(.note.gnu.build-id) }
-
- /DISCARD/ : {
- *(.note.GNU-stack)
- *(.gnu_debuglink)
- *(.interp)
- *(.dynsym)
- *(.dynstr)
- *(.dynamic)
- *(.hash .gnu.hash)
- *(.comment)
- }
-}
